What Masonry Repair Addresses
Brick and mortar do not fail together. Mortar is deliberately the weaker of the two — it is meant to wear and be replaced rather than let the brick take the damage — so masonry repair nearly always begins as mortar work.
The mechanism in Connecticut is freeze-thaw. Water gets into an open joint or into the face of a brick, freezes, expands by roughly a tenth of its volume, and pushes the material apart. Then it thaws and the process repeats. A stack goes through that cycle dozens of times a winter, and the damage is cumulative.
What you see from the ground is the end of that sequence: joints raked back, brick faces flaking away in sheets, and in bad cases whole bricks that have lost their outer face entirely. The repair is to cut out and replace what has failed — the joints by repointing, the brick faces by cutting out and replacing individual bricks.
What Masonry Damage Looks Like
All of these are visible from the ground with a decent look, and most are visible from a photograph.
Joints raked back or missing mortar
The first stage and the cheapest to address. Repointing at this point avoids everything below.
Brick faces flaking or popping off
Spalling. The brick has absorbed water and the face has come away. It does not grow back.
Mortar you can scrape out with a key
A useful field test: sound mortar resists, failed mortar crumbles.
Stepped cracks following the joints
Movement, which needs a different assessment from ordinary weathering.
White powdery bloom on the brick
Efflorescence — salts brought out of the masonry by water moving through it.
Brick or mortar debris on the roof
Material is coming off the stack, usually from the most exposed top courses.
Repointing and Brick Replacement
Repointing means cutting the failed mortar out of the joints to a sufficient depth and packing in new mortar. Depth matters — a surface smear over old mortar looks right for a season and then falls out — and so does the mix.
Matching the mortar is the part that gets overlooked. Older Connecticut chimneys were built with soft, lime-rich mortar, and putting a hard modern cement mortar into those joints does real damage: the new mortar is stronger than the brick, so the next freeze-thaw cycle takes the face off the brick rather than the mortar. On older stacks the mix should be matched to what is there.
Spalled brick is cut out individually and replaced, which is slower than it sounds because the replacement has to match in size, color and density. Where the top courses have gone across the board, taking the stack down to a sound course and rebuilding upward is often quicker and better than replacing brick by brick.
Frequently Asked Questions
Is brick repair the same as masonry repair?
Yes — they are two names for the same work, which is why this is one page rather than two. Masonry repair covers the brick, the mortar and the joints between them.
Why is the mortar crumbling?
Freeze-thaw, in almost every case. Water gets into the joint, freezes, expands and pushes it apart, then thaws and repeats. Connecticut winters put a stack through that cycle repeatedly, and mortar is designed to take that damage in preference to the brick.
Does the whole chimney need repointing?
Rarely. Damage concentrates in the most exposed places — the top courses, the weather side, and anywhere water collects — so partial repointing is the normal answer. A stack that genuinely needs it all over is usually a rebuild conversation.
Does it matter what mortar is used?
On an older chimney it matters a great deal. Modern cement mortar is harder than old soft brick, so when it freezes the brick face gives way instead of the joint. Matching the mix to the original is the difference between a repair and accelerated damage.
Will spalling spread if we leave it?
Yes. Once a brick has lost its fired outer face, the soft interior absorbs water far more readily, so the damage accelerates rather than stabilising. Spalled brick is the argument for not waiting another winter.
Can masonry work be done in cold weather?
Not well. Mortar needs temperatures above freezing to cure properly, so repointing and brick replacement are warm-season jobs in Connecticut. If a stack needs stabilising before then, that is a different and more limited conversation.
